Wireless Neckband Speaker Market: Emerging Trends, Growth Drivers, and Future Outlook
The wireless neckband speaker market is gaining strong momentum as consumers look for more convenient and immersive audio solutions. Unlike traditional headphones or portable speakers, neckband speakers rest comfortably around the neck, offering a blend of personal and open-air listening. This unique positioning allows users to stay aware of their surroundings while still enjoying high-quality sound, making it an attractive option for fitness enthusiasts, remote workers, gamers, and everyday users.
One of the main factors driving this market forward is the growing demand for hands-free audio. Many people prefer an audio device that doesn’t block their ears, especially during outdoor activities like jogging, cycling, or walking. Neckband speakers meet this need by providing a safer listening option compared to earbuds, which can isolate external sounds. At the same time, they deliver rich audio quality, making them ideal for both entertainment and productivity.
Another major trend shaping the market is the increasing integration of smart features. Modern wireless neckband speakers often come equipped with voice assistants, touch controls, and seamless Bluetooth connectivity. Advanced microphones and noise-reduction technologies also enhance their functionality, especially for users who frequently take calls or attend virtual meetings. As remote work continues to grow globally, these speakers provide a comfortable and practical alternative to wearing bulky headsets for long hours.
Battery performance is also improving steadily. Manufacturers are focusing on long-lasting batteries that support extended playback and quick-charging capabilities. This improvement makes neckband speakers more reliable for daily use, especially for people who travel frequently or engage in long workout sessions. Lightweight materials and ergonomic designs further contribute to user comfort, encouraging wider adoption.
The market is also benefiting from expanding use cases. In the gaming industry, neckband speakers allow players to enjoy immersive audio without overheating their ears or feeling confined by traditional headphones. Fitness communities appreciate the open-ear design, and business professionals value the convenience during calls and presentations. These diverse applications are creating new growth opportunities for manufacturers.
However, the increasing competition in this space is pushing brands to differentiate themselves through innovation. Companies are experimenting with enhanced bass output, flexible materials, waterproof designs, and customizable sound profiles. Price variations across segments—from budget-friendly to premium models—are helping the market cater to a wide range of consumers. This competition is likely to accelerate over the next few years as more electronics brands enter the category.
Looking ahead, the wireless neckband speaker market is expected to continue its upward trajectory. The combination of comfort, convenience, and evolving technology makes it an appealing audio solution for modern lifestyles. As consumer awareness grows and product offerings expand, neckband speakers are set to become a mainstream choice in the wearable audio segment.
